When the Soviet Union fell, Cuban leader Fidel Castro responded by renewing his commitment to Communism.

What happened in Cuba when the Soviet Union fell?

Even though Cuba had lost their most powerful ally, Fidel Castro remained adamant that Communism was the best way forward.

As a result, he renewed his commitment to communism and continued down the communist path with Cuba.
